What Is The Maximum Occupancy Of A Private Jet?

Flying on a private jet is a luxurious experience. It offers comfort, convenience, and privacy that commercial airlines cannot match. But one question often arises: What is the maximum occupancy of a private jet? The answer can vary based on several factors, including the type of jet, its configuration, and its intended use. In this article, we will explore these aspects in detail, helping you understand how many passengers can comfortably travel on a private jet.

What is a Private Jet?

Before we dive into occupancy limits, let’s define what a private jet is. A private jet is an aircraft designed for the exclusive use of individuals or groups. Unlike commercial airliners, which serve the public, private jets are often used for business, leisure, or urgent travel needs. They come in various sizes and types, each catering to different needs and preferences.

Types of Private Jets

Private jets can be categorized based on their size and range. Here are the main types:

Very Light Jets (VLJs):

Capacity: 2 to 6 passengers.

Description: These jets are small and lightweight. They are perfect for short flights. Popular examples include the Cessna Citation Mustang and the Embraer Phenom 100.

Light Jets:

Capacity: 6 to 8 passengers.

Description: Light jets offer more space and range than VLJs. They can travel longer distances and are suitable for short-haul flights. Examples include the Learjet 75 and the Cessna Citation CJ4.

Midsize Jets:

Capacity: 8 to 10 passengers.

Description: Midsize jets provide additional comfort and range. They often come with more amenities, making them ideal for longer flights. Popular models include the Hawker 800XP and Citation XLS+.

Super Midsize Jets:

Capacity: 10 to 12 passengers.

Description: These jets offer more cabin space and range, making them suitable for transcontinental flights. Examples include the Bombardier Challenger 350 and Gulfstream G280.

Heavy Jets:

Capacity: 12 to 19 passengers.

Description: Heavy jets are designed for long-distance travel. They often come with luxurious amenities, including full-service galleys and spacious cabins. Popular models include the Gulfstream G550 and Bombardier Global 6000.

Ultra Long Range Jets:

Capacity: 12 to 19 passengers.

Description: These jets are built for the longest distances and can fly nonstop between continents. They offer the highest level of luxury and comfort. Examples include the Gulfstream G650ER and Bombardier Global 7500.

Factors Influencing Maximum Occupancy

The maximum occupancy of a private jet is influenced by several factors:

Jet Size:

The size of the jet is the most significant factor. Larger jets can accommodate more passengers. For example, a small light jet can hold 6 passengers, while a heavy jet can carry up to 19 passengers.

Cabin Configuration:

The interior layout of the jet affects how many passengers it can hold. Some jets may have additional seating, while others may prioritize space for comfort. Custom configurations can also change the occupancy.

Regulatory Requirements:

Aviation authorities set regulations regarding seating and safety. These regulations can impact how many people can legally be on board.

Passenger Comfort:

Luxury is a significant aspect of private flying. Some owners may choose to limit occupancy to ensure maximum comfort. For instance, a jet rated for 12 passengers may only be configured to seat 8 for a more spacious experience.

Intended Use:

Some jets are designed specifically for business travel, which may require more space for meetings and work. Others are used for leisure, emphasizing comfort and relaxation.

Maximum Occupancy by Jet Type

Let’s look at how many passengers can typically be accommodated on various types of private jets:

Very Light Jets

Example: Cessna Citation Mustang

Maximum Occupancy: 4 to 5 passengers

Description: Very light jets are compact and often have a more basic interior. They are great for quick trips with a small group.

Light Jets

Example: Learjet 75

Maximum Occupancy: 6 to 8 passengers

Description: Light jets have a bit more space and comfort. They are suitable for small groups traveling for business or leisure.

Midsize Jets

Example: Hawker 800XP

Maximum Occupancy: 8 to 10 passengers

Description: Midsize jets provide more legroom and amenities, making them ideal for longer flights.

Super Midsize Jets

Example: Bombardier Challenger 350

Maximum Occupancy: 10 to 12 passengers

Description: Super midsize jets combine comfort and range. They can handle medium to long-haul flights and are great for family trips or business meetings.

Heavy Jets

Example: Gulfstream G550

Maximum Occupancy: 12 to 19 passengers

Description: Heavy jets offer luxurious interiors and are suitable for long-distance travel. They are often used for business trips requiring meetings on the go.

Ultra Long Range Jets

Example: Gulfstream G650ER

Maximum Occupancy: 12 to 19 passengers

Description: These jets provide the highest level of luxury and can fly long distances without refueling. They are perfect for international travel with a large group.

Understanding Aircraft Configuration

The interior of a private jet is highly customizable. Different configurations can influence how many people can be comfortably accommodated. Here are some common configurations:

Standard Seating: This is the basic arrangement with seats typically arranged in a club configuration or rows. It maximizes the number of passengers but may compromise comfort.

Luxury Seating: Some jets are outfitted with more spacious seats that recline fully. These configurations can reduce the maximum occupancy but significantly enhance comfort.

Meeting Spaces: Many larger jets have configurations that include a table and additional space for meetings. This often reduces the number of available seats.

Rest Areas: Some high-end jets include private bedrooms or lounges. These features prioritize luxury over maximum seating capacity.

Baggage Space: The amount of luggage you can bring also affects occupancy. More luggage space may require fewer passengers to ensure the aircraft is within its weight limits.

The Importance of Weight and Balance

When considering maximum occupancy, it’s crucial to think about weight and balance. Every aircraft has specific weight limits, including maximum takeoff weight, maximum landing weight, and weight distribution limits.

Weight Considerations

Passenger Weight: On average, each passenger is estimated to weigh around 200 pounds when considering luggage. Larger groups may quickly reach the weight limit of a smaller jet.

Luggage Weight: The weight of luggage must also be considered. A few large bags can add significant weight. This is especially important for longer trips.

Fuel Load: The weight of fuel also impacts how many passengers can be on board. Longer flights require more fuel, which reduces the capacity for passengers and luggage.

Balance Considerations

Center of Gravity: Proper weight distribution is critical for safe flight. Overloading one side or end of the aircraft can lead to control issues.

Distribution of Passengers: Careful planning is required to ensure that passengers are seated in a way that maintains balance. Flight crews often have specific guidelines for loading passengers and cargo.

Common Misconceptions

Many misconceptions surround private jet occupancy. Let’s address a few of them:

Misconception 1: Private Jets Are Always Fully Booked

Reality: Private jets are often booked based on individual needs. It’s common for individuals or small groups to charter a jet for specific flights. Therefore, they are rarely fully booked like commercial airlines.

Misconception 2: You Can Always Bring More Passengers

Reality: Each aircraft has strict regulations regarding occupancy. Just because a jet has seats does not mean it can accommodate additional passengers. Weight limits and safety regulations must always be adhered to.

Misconception 3: All Private Jets Have the Same Capacity

Reality: The capacity of private jets varies significantly based on size, configuration, and model. Not all jets are created equal, and understanding the specifics is essential.

Planning Your Flight

When planning to fly on a private jet, there are several considerations to keep in mind:

Determine the Number of Passengers: Knowing how many people will be traveling is crucial. This information helps in selecting the right type of jet.

Consider Your Destination: The distance of the flight will influence the type of jet needed. Longer flights may require larger, more fuel-efficient aircraft.

Assess Your Needs: Consider if you need amenities like Wi-Fi, meeting spaces, or sleeping areas. Your requirements will help determine the right aircraft.

Understand Your Budget: Private jet charter costs can vary widely. Understanding your budget will help you choose an appropriate aircraft.

Choose a Reputable Charter Service: Working with a reliable private jet charter service can ensure a smooth experience. They can help you choose the right aircraft based on your needs and preferences.
